Do people from Canada come to America for healthcare?

"Only 90 of those 18,000 Canadians had received care in the United States; only 20 of them had done so electively." So, the Health Affairs researchers found no evidence for the idea that Canadians are fleeing their health system, and concluded that it's a "persistent myth."Feb 7, 2017

How many people come from Canada for healthcare?

A policy brief — titled Flight of the Sick, by the Calgary-based think tank secondstreet.org — says 217,500 Canadians left the country for health care in 2017, according to Statistics Canada. If those travelling with the patients are included in the count, the total rises to 369,700 people.Mar 12, 2019

Is Canada's healthcare better than the US?

Both countries are ranked relatively high in international surveys of healthcare quality according to the World Health Organization (WHO). Both countries are relatively wealthy compared to much of the world, with long life expectancy. But Canadian life expectancy is slightly higher.May 11, 2021

Do Canadians approve of their healthcare system?

Public opinion. According to a 2020 survey, 75% of Canadians "were proud of their health-care system."
